JAFZA Payroll Compliance Requirements
JAFZA companies process payroll within the JAFZA free zone employment framework — which has specific requirements that differ in some respects from mainland MOHRE payroll compliance:
JAFZA WPS processing: JAFZA companies submit salary information files through the JAFZA employment portal — not through the standard MOHRE WPS pathway used by mainland businesses. Understanding and correctly using the JAFZA submission process is essential for compliance.
JAFZA employment records: JAFZA maintains its own employment records system. Employee records — salary data, visa status, Emirates ID — must be maintained correctly in the JAFZA system as well as in the company’s own payroll records.
Visa quota alignment: JAFZA visa quotas must be aligned with actual employee headcount. Managing the payroll and visa records consistently — ensuring employees on the payroll are correctly linked to their visa status — is an important compliance management discipline.
Gratuity under JAFZA employment: UAE Labour Law gratuity provisions apply to JAFZA employees. We calculate and manage gratuity accruals for all JAFZA employees correctly within the free zone employment framework.

International Staff Package Management
JAFZA companies employ significant numbers of international professionals — senior executives, technical specialists, and commercial professionals — with comprehensive international compensation packages. Our international staff package management covers:
Housing allowances: International executives in JAFZA companies typically receive housing allowances either as a cash component of salary or as employer-paid accommodation. We manage both approaches correctly within the UAE payroll framework.
Schooling allowances: Executives relocating to Dubai with families commonly receive schooling allowances for dependent children. We manage annual schooling allowance payments — either as lump sum payments at the start of each academic year or as monthly instalments — correctly within payroll.
Annual flight allowances: International employees on extended assignments typically receive annual return flights to their home country. We manage these as either a cash allowance or as a reimbursement — correctly documented and processed in the appropriate payroll period.
Home country benefit preservation: Some international assignment packages include employer contributions to home country pension or social security schemes. While these are typically managed outside UAE payroll, we coordinate with home country payroll advisors and document the UAE payroll component correctly.
Payroll Audit Support for JAFZA Companies
JAFZA companies — particularly those with institutional investors, bank financing, or regulatory oversight — may be subject to payroll audit requirements. Our payroll service provides the documentation and records needed to support auditor review:
Complete payroll records: We maintain complete, auditable payroll records for all periods under our management — monthly payroll runs, WPS submissions, payment confirmations, and calculation workings — available in a format that facilitates efficient auditor review.
Gratuity provision reconciliation: We produce a gratuity provision reconciliation at any point — showing the current gratuity liability for all employees, the movement in the period, and the reconciliation with the balance sheet provision.
Leave liability documentation: Current leave balance for all employees, valued at current salary rates — the documentation needed for balance sheet disclosure of the leave liability.
HR cost analysis by period: Monthly HR cost analysis for any specified period — useful for budget versus actual variance analysis, investor reporting, and due diligence requests.
